Ira Levy is an associate managing director in the Cyber Data and Resilience practice at Kroll where he leads the global services lines of M&A, advisory and frameworks. He leverages more than 25 years of experience in both the public and private information technology sector, working within telecommunications, software development, managed service providers, government and nonprofits.

Prior to joining Kroll, Levy served as the executive director of the administrative modernization program at the University of Maryland. Before that, he held the title of chief operating officer at Affiniti, a national telecommunications and managed services company where he brought multiple ML based security service products to market. Additionally, he previously served as chief information officer at Howard County Government in Maryland.

Levy’s notable achievements include bringing five technology products to market including a network security solution later acquired by a national managed services company. Additionally, Levy led the deployment of the One Maryland Inter-County Broadband Network (ICBN), which received a $115 million federal grant and was acknowledged by the White House for innovation and impact. Levy has also participated in numerous associations including the University of Maryland’s Presidential 5G/6G Advisory committee, as well as serving as a board member of the cybersecurity program at Keiser University, Mid-Atlantic CIO Forum, NACO, NATOA’s CIO Advisory Council, the Howard County Tech Council, Digital Governing Communities, the Howard County Public School System Technology Vision committee, the Howard Community College Commission for the Future and as a founding board member of the Howard County Tech Council. 

Further, Levy was named the HTC Technology Advocate of the Year, as well as the Public-Sector CIO of the Year by The Tech Council of Maryland. Levy was later named Smart CIO by SmartCEO magazine for his efforts addressing problems with innovative solutions and forging new partnerships to achieve significant cost savings.
